Of course, networked video is an LP play, but it also brings big benefits to operations, customer service, merchandising, and more.
This month’s feature story on page 6 tells the tale of Kroger’s tech prowess: The grocery giant built a VMS (video management system) from the ground up to accommodate the needs of a variety of enterprise users. Of course, not all retailers are equipped to take on such a massive DIY project. Fortunately, the IP video market is full of providers selling off-the-shelf solutions with features that serve stakeholders far beyond the LP department.
